Net income. £73.3 million (2023) [2] Number of employees. 465 (2023) [2] Website. bigyellow.co.uk. Big Yellow Group plc is a self-storage company based in Bagshot, England. [3] It is the largest self-storage company in the United Kingdom and is a constituent of the FTSE 250 Index and listed on the London Stock Exchange. [4]
Operating income. £ 230.4 million (2023) [3] Net income. £ 200.2 million (2023) [3] Website. www.safestore.co.uk. Safestore is the UK’s largest and Europe’s second largest provider of self-storage. [4] [5] It is listed on the London Stock Exchange and is a constituent of the FTSE 250 Index .
Self storage. Self storage (a shorthand for "self-service storage," and also known as "device storage") is an industry that rents storage space (such as rooms, lockers, containers, and/or outdoor space), also known as "storage units," to tenants, usually on a short-term basis (often month-to-month). Stor-Age, or Stor-Age Property REIT Limited, is a South African public company based in Cape Town. The company is a real estate investment trust that owns, acquires, develops and manages self-storage assets in metropolitan areas across South Africa and the United Kingdom. StorageMart. StorageMart is a chain of self-storage facilities headquartered in Columbia, Missouri [1] that operates facilities across the USA, Canada and the UK. StorageMart was founded in 1999 by Gordon Burnam, who had been involved in the self-storage industry since 1974. Burnam's four children each hold executive positions within the company.
Lok'nStore Group PLC. £25.3 million. Up 12.1% (2022: £22.5 million) Lok'nStore Group PLC [1] is a provider of self storage space in the UK. The company rents individual, storage units to both business and domestic / household customers. Lok'nStore has been listed on the Alternative Investment Market (AIM) since June 2000.
LOVESPACE was established in 2011 by cofounders Brett Akker and Carl August Ameln. Brett Akker had previously founded the carsharing company Streetcar. Carl August Ameln was the founder of City Self-Storage, a multi-national chain of self-storage centres. Ameln had previously been an investor in Streetcar. [2] [4]
Rodger Ian Dudding (born 21 December 1937) is a British business magnate in the self-storage industry. Nicknamed "Mr Lock Up" by customers and "RD" by staff, Dudding owns more than 12,000 garages and as of February 2015 was worth an estimated £162 million, making him "the largest private owner of garages" in the United Kingdom.
